Skills

Document and report skills stand aside when a first-party document connector is attached.

What

The document and report artifact skills now describe themselves as deferring to an attached first-party document connector, so requests for pages, docs, memos, plans, notes and reports use that connector's tools instead of building an artifact.

Details
  • Third-party tools such as Notion, Confluence or Google Docs integrations that are not host-designated never trigger this deferral.
  • The change is in the skill descriptions; whether it takes effect depends on a connector actually being attached.
